HOUSE RESOLUTION NO. 130
BY REPRESENTATIVE JAMES
A RESOLUTION
To designate Monday, June 1, 2015, as Boys & Girls Club of Greater Baton Rouge Youth
Legislature Day at the state capitol.
WHEREAS, it is appropriate to commend the Youth Legislature for its outstanding
achievements and community service for thirty-seven years to more than forty thousand
students in Louisiana, and to designate Monday June 1, 2015, as Boys & Girls Club of
Greater Baton Rouge Youth Legislature Day at the state capitol; and
WHEREAS, annually, the Youth Legislature provides a valuable educational and life
experience to more than one thousand eight hundred middle school students; and
WHEREAS, through the Youth Legislature's two-day mock legislative session at the
Old State Capitol, students learn the process and procedures of state government through a
hands on experience; and
WHEREAS, students are given the opportunity to run for and elect a governor and
House and Senate officers, participate in the legislative process by writing, sponsoring, and
debating bills, and lead and serve on legislative committees while learning to speak before
an audience; and
WHEREAS, participants of the Youth Legislature may also serve as members of the
press by gathering and reporting information about bills, legislators, senators, and the
governor's cabinet; and
WHEREAS, the Youth Legislature provides students with an experience that
supports and solidifies information that is studied in classrooms and gives students an
opportunity to enhance their writing, research, and public speaking skills; and
WHEREAS, the Youth Legislature promotes and encourages youth leadership
characteristics, participation, cooperation, and teamwork among peers and gives students the

confidence needed to participate in leadership roles in high school and in their respective
communities.
TH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the House of Representatives of the
Legislature of Louisiana does hereby designate Monday, June 1, 2015, as Boys & Girls Club
of Greater Baton Rouge Youth Legislature Day at the state capitol and does hereby extend
enduring appreciation to the organization, its volunteers, and participating educators for the
knowledge, discipline, and integrity they bestow upon the youth of Louisiana.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that a suitable copy of this Resolution be transmitted
to Paula Braud, program director of the Boys & Girls Club of Greater Baton Rouge Youth
Legislature.
